The high-octane rivalry between the Indiana Fever and the New York Liberty reached a fever pitch on August 12, 2026, as both teams battled for late-season momentum at the Barclays Center. In a game defined by rapid-fire perimeter shooting and tactical defensive shifts, the Liberty managed to secure a narrow 94-89 victory. This matchup highlighted the continued evolution of the league's premier backcourt stars, drawing a capacity crowd and massive digital viewership across streaming platforms.



Player Team Points Rebounds Assists FG%
Sabrina Ionescu Liberty 28 5 8 48%
Caitlin Clark Fever 26 4 12 42%
Breanna Stewart Liberty 21 11 4 51%
Aliyah Boston Fever 18 13 3 55%
Jonquel Jones Liberty 14 9 2 46%
Lexie Hull Fever 12 3 2 40%

A Tactical Chess Match: The Clark-Ionescu Perimeter War

The 2026 WNBA season has been defined by the soaring popularity of the Indiana Fever, led by third-year phenom Caitlin Clark. However, the New York Liberty utilized their veteran experience to disrupt Indiana’s rhythm early in the first half. New York employed a "blitz" defensive scheme on Clark, forcing the ball out of her hands and daring the Fever’s secondary scorers to execute in high-pressure windows.

Sabrina Ionescu countered Clark’s playmaking with a masterclass in pick-and-roll efficiency. By the mid-third quarter, Ionescu had already notched four triples, stretching the Indiana defense and opening lanes for Breanna Stewart. The Fever responded with a 12-2 run fueled by Aliyah Boston’s dominance in the paint, but the Liberty’s bench depth eventually neutralized the threat. New York’s ability to transition from a half-court set to a fast-break offense within seconds remains the benchmark for the league in 2026.

Key factors that decided the box score included:



  • Second Chance Points: The Liberty outpaced the Fever 18-10 in second-chance opportunities.
  • Three-Point Efficiency: New York shot a collective 39% from deep compared to Indiana's 34%.
  • Turnover Margin: Indiana’s 14 turnovers led to 22 points for the Liberty, a gap the Fever could not close in the final minutes.

Playoff Implications and the Late-August Schedule

This victory solidifies the New York Liberty's position at the top of the Eastern Conference standings as they eye a potential championship run. For the Indiana Fever, the loss provides a crucial learning moment as they fight to maintain a top-four seed, ensuring home-court advantage in the opening round of the 2026 WNBA Playoffs.

The upcoming schedule for both franchises remains grueling as the regular season enters its final stretch:



  • August 15, 2026: Indiana Fever vs. Chicago Sky (The "Midwest Rivalry" continues).
  • August 16, 2026: New York Liberty at Las Vegas Aces (A potential Finals preview).
  • August 19, 2026: Indiana Fever vs. Connecticut Sun.

As the 2026 season progresses, the box score results from these head-to-head matchups will weigh heavily on the MVP race. Breanna Stewart and Caitlin Clark remain the frontrunners, with every rebound and assist recorded in these mid-August games serving as a resume-builder for the league's highest individual honors. Fans should expect the intensity to increase as the "Magic Number" for playoff clinching drops across the league.
